#0d04af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0d04af is composed of 5.1% red, 1.6%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.6%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 243.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 35.1%. #0d04af color hex could be obtained by blending #1a08ff with #00005f.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#0d04af

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#efee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d04af

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57575c is the less saturated color, while #0d04af is the most saturated one.
